The most popular time to visit Haddington is during the summer months, especially July, when the weather is pleasantly warm and inviting. Average temperatures hover around 65°F, making it a wonderful time for outdoor exploration, whether you're strolling through the charming streets or enjoying the beautiful landscapes of East Lothian.
During the peak season, from June to August, Haddington experiences an influx of visitors. This period is vibrant with local events, including festivals that showcase the region's rich history and culture. You'll find plenty of opportunities for sightseeing, from the stunning St. Mary's Church to the picturesque River Tyne, all while soaking up the lively atmosphere that permeates the town.
For those who appreciate leisurely outdoor activities, summer is the great season to engage in hiking or cycling along the scenic coastal paths and nearby countryside. The long daylight hours offer ample time for exploration, allowing you to fully immerse yourself in the area's natural beauty. Additionally, the local cuisine shines during this period, with many restaurants featuring seasonal dishes made from fresh, local ingredients.
If you're looking for a more budget-friendly time to visit, consider coming in late autumn, particularly in November. While the weather starts to cool down, with temperatures averaging around 48°F, you'll find fewer crowds and more opportunities to enjoy a tranquil experience. This can be a great time to delve into Haddington's history at its museums or to enjoy cozy evenings at local pubs.
